Did you ever think you could listen to high-fidelity audio out of a little metal cylinder just 88mm long? The Taiwanese company Agios Technology thinks that day has arrived with its Podio digital music playback device. The company says it has spent two years developing the device, which features a proprietary microamp and a full-range Foster speaker adapted from speakers intended for notebooks and palmtop devices. Agios says the Podio is the first pocket-sized hi-fi device, offering full-range, crisp and natural-sounding audio without needing earbuds. The cylinder has a speaker at the front and control buttons at the opposite end, and Agois is pitching it as an ideal music solution for bicyclists, as well as folks who enjoy doing darn near anything with music—exercising, walking, relaxing, working…even sleeping.

Turner Sends Toons and News to iTunes
Apple and Turner Broadcasting announced today that selected programming from CNN and Cartoon Network will be available for download on Apple’s iTunes Music Store for $1.99 per episode.
Both Cartoon Network and CNN have been offering free podcasts to iTunes users over the last cople months, including podcasts from Cartoon Networks’ Adult Swim and CNN’s Late Edition with Wolf Blitzer and Reliable Sources.
Programming now available via iTnes includes original episodes of CNN’s documentary series CNN Presents, along with Cartoon Network staples Johnny Bravo (season one) and Adult Swim’s Aqua teen Hunger Force, The Venture Bros., and Sealab 2021 (season three). Fans can also expect to see Cartoon Network shows Foster’s Home for Imaginary Friends and Squirrel Boy appear on iTunes in coming weeks.
Cartoon Network Developing Game Slate
Cable’s Cartoon Network today unveiled a slate of upcoming video game released based on its original animated programming. The games will be developed jointly with several developers, including Midway Games, Crave Entertainment, D3 Publisher of America, and the Game Factory; according to Cartoon Network, titles in development include games based on the shows Camp Lazlo,The Grim Adventures of Billy & Mandy,Aqua Teen Hunger Force, and Hi Hi Puffy AmiYumi.
By working with a variety of game developers, Cartoon Networks intends to develop a range of properties which collectively span most major gaming platforms.
